Ultra Low Volume (ULV) sprayers are advanced equipment designed to disperse precise volumes of liquid formulations into fine droplets, ensuring efficient coverage while minimizing waste. The market for ULV sprayers is expanding significantly, driven by their versatility across multiple applications. These sprayers are particularly valued for their ability to deliver high efficacy in controlling pests, pathogens, and harmful microorganisms in various environments. In agriculture, ULV sprayers have revolutionized pest and disease management. Their ability to produce fine droplets ensures uniform coverage over crops, minimizing chemical wastage and maximizing effectiveness. Farmers increasingly rely on these sprayers for precision application of pesticides, fungicides, and herbicides, particularly in large-scale farming operations where efficiency and environmental conservation are paramount. The demand for ULV sprayers in agriculture is further bolstered by the rising awareness about sustainable farming practices and the need to reduce water consumption.
Additionally, ULV sprayers cater to the specific needs of different crops, ranging from cereals to horticultural plants. The adaptability of these sprayers to handle various formulations and target diverse pests makes them a crucial tool for modern agriculture. Governments and agricultural organizations are also promoting the use of ULV technology to mitigate the impact of chemical overuse on ecosystems and to improve crop yields in regions facing challenging climatic conditions.
In hospitals and laboratories, ULV sprayers are indispensable for maintaining sterile environments. These sprayers are widely used for the disinfection of operating rooms, patient wards, and laboratory spaces, ensuring that harmful pathogens are eradicated efficiently. Their capability to generate ultra-fine droplets allows for deep penetration into hard-to-reach areas, providing comprehensive sanitation. The healthcare sector's growing focus on infection control and adherence to stringent hygiene standards drives the adoption of ULV sprayers.
The ongoing COVID-19 pandemic further highlighted the importance of these sprayers in preventing the spread of contagious diseases. Hospitals and laboratories now prioritize the use of ULV technology for routine and emergency disinfection processes. The ease of operation and portability of these devices also make them a preferred choice for healthcare professionals, ensuring rapid and effective sanitation in high-risk environments.
Shopping malls and other commercial spaces rely heavily on ULV sprayers to maintain a safe and hygienic environment for visitors and employees. These sprayers are effective in covering large areas quickly, making them ideal for high-footfall locations. From disinfecting escalator handrails to air ducts and common areas, ULV sprayers help mitigate the risk of disease transmission in public spaces. Their ability to deliver consistent and thorough disinfection has become a key aspect of maintaining public health and safety.
Moreover, the rising consumer awareness regarding hygiene has prompted mall operators to adopt advanced cleaning technologies like ULV sprayers. This trend has also been supported by governmental regulations requiring stringent cleanliness protocols in commercial establishments. The versatility and efficiency of ULV sprayers in disinfecting diverse surfaces and ensuring long-lasting protection further enhance their appeal in the commercial sector.
Beyond agriculture, healthcare, and shopping malls, ULV sprayers find applications in several other sectors such as residential sanitation, animal husbandry, and industrial cleaning. For residential settings, these sprayers are increasingly used to control pests and sanitize homes, particularly in urban areas facing challenges like mosquito infestations. In animal husbandry, ULV technology aids in disinfecting barns and livestock enclosures, ensuring disease prevention and promoting animal health.
Industrial facilities also leverage ULV sprayers for cleaning and maintaining production areas, storage units, and machinery. Their ability to deliver precise and targeted disinfection enhances operational safety and minimizes downtime. The growing awareness of ULV sprayers' utility across diverse sectors continues to expand their market potential, solidifying their position as a versatile and essential tool for sanitation and pest control.

1. What is a ULV sprayer used for? ULV sprayers are used for precise application of liquid formulations to control pests, pathogens, and ensure sanitation.
2. How do ULV sprayers work? They atomize liquids into ultra-fine droplets, providing uniform coverage and efficient application.
3. Are ULV sprayers suitable for agricultural use? Yes, they are highly effective for pest control, disease management, and crop protection in agriculture.
4. Can ULV sprayers be used indoors? Yes, they are widely used indoors for disinfection in hospitals, labs, and residential areas.
5. What are the benefits of ULV sprayers? They offer precision, reduced chemical usage, and comprehensive coverage, improving overall efficacy.
6. What industries use ULV sprayers? Agriculture, healthcare, commercial spaces, animal husbandry, and industrial cleaning are key users.
7. What is the droplet size produced by ULV sprayers? They typically produce droplets of 5-50 microns for optimal coverage and penetration.
8. Are ULV sprayers environmentally friendly? Many models now support eco-friendly formulations, aligning with sustainable practices.
9. How are ULV sprayers powered? They can be powered by electricity, batteries, or fuel, depending on the model.
